Strange one if anybody has any suggestions. I have a few Atlas OCAP 1056 jp1.3 remotes. One has died for all intents and purposes. However if I plug the dead one into an FTDI cable I can upload and download to the remote. Also when it is connected to the PC and JP1 cable I can use the remote as normal no problem. As soon as I unplug it is unresponsive again. I have tried new batteries etc but onto no avail. Anybody any ideas as to what could be wrong with it?

The fact that the remote works connected to the cable suggests
it doesn’t get power from the batteries.
If the battery contacts aren’t corroded you probably have a wire or circuit board trace damaged.
If you can find the damage you might be able to solder it.

if very old batteries were left in the remote for a long period of time it is possible that the battery terminals have corroded.

Try using a metal file to clean the connections.
